共阴极数码管是指八段数码管的八段发光二极管的阴极(负极)都连在一起,而阳极对应的各段可分别控制;
数码管点亮需要一定电流,而单片机IO口通常为高电平时输出电流能力小于为低电平时灌入电流能力,所以通常IO口为低时控制数码管比较合理,此时应该使用共阳极数码管。
数码管里数字的每一段其实都是一个LED,共阳就是数码管里每一段LED灯的阳极连在一起,共阴就是阴极连在一起。
一般来说,单片机的拉电流能力比灌电流能力弱,推荐用共阳的。
其实就是组成数码管的LED是正极并在一起还是负极并一起。
一般认为共阳(就是正极)方便驱动,因为单片机拉电流比较大。
其实现在单片机驱动能力够强了,共阴共阳区别不大了。
共阴就是将阴极接在一个网络点上,用阳极来控制灯的状态
共阳就反过来,理论上是这样的,而且都可以,实际上还需要确认电流电压匹配,以点亮灯为最终目标
使用方法基本一样,无非是公共端接高电平或低电平的区别,放到程序里面,代码也基本类似(0 1互换一下就行)。
从寿命来说,我感觉共阴皮实点(不过也可能是我用的样品不够多,至少共阳的我用坏过好几个,共阴的只坏过一个)。
主要是led连接的方式不一样